Here's what the humans have to say about me:
Snowball is a husky, and she’s about 5 years old. She had one owner her entire life, but he passed away in February. He was an elderly gentleman, so she was used to a quiet home and being the center of attention. She loves to go on walks, she loves to chase balls, and she loves being outside in general. A fenced in yard would be preferred for her so she can play without fear of escape.. Snowball is skiddish and shy, and doesn’t love being in my loud house with 2 kids. She would be the perfect companion to someone with no children. She doesn’t interact with my other pets, she just avoids them, so there are no worries about other animals. She is a good girl, she just needs to be in the right home. Unfortunately that isn’t mine. Snowball was depressed when I met her, but has perked back up over the past few months. I would keep her if I could, but I can tell how anxious she is when my kiddos are home. I just want her to be HAPPY and LOVED 💜
